Cherokee County sheriff’s deputies arrested an area man Wednesday night after he allegedly tried to break into a car on an impound storage lot.
Justin Brown, 19, was booked by Sheriff’s Deputy Tommy Moore for attempted burglary and possession of controlled drug. Reports state Curtis Russell heard his dogs barking at Rose’s and Rich’s’ Wrecker Service and went outside to investigate. Brown was allegedly trying to get inside a car impounded in August. He told Moore he was trying to get a textboook from the vehicle. He also had three Darvocet pills in the vehicle he was driving, and admitted to Moore he had no prescription at this time for the pills.
In an unrelated matter, Dana Kelly said Monday a man knocked out her outside porch light and kicked in her door because he was wanting to retrieve some clothes. He allegedly held a knife to her throat and cut the phone line in her kitchen.
